Overview

KB Securities Co. Ltd. offers a unique financial product, the KOSDAQ 150 TR Exchange Traded Note 65, which is crafted to mirror the performance of the KOSDAQ 150 Total Return Index. This index captures the essence of South Korea's dynamic and innovation-forward KOSDAQ market, renowned for its plethora of technology and innovation-centric companies. Exchange Traded Notes (ETNs), such as the one issued by KB Securities, provide an essential tool for investors aiming to gain exposure to specific market indices or sectors without the complexities of directly buying the underlying securities. Unlike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s), ETNs are structured as debt securities, making them a distinct investment vehicle issued by financial institutions. By focusing on the KOSDAQ 150, KB Securities facilitates investor access to a diversified portfolio of high-growth potential companies, thereby offering an avenue to participate in the economic expansion driven by South Korea's tech and innovation-led entities.
